Tolgay Kizilelma, PhD has over twenty-five years of industry business-IT experience covering the whole IT spectrum. He is currently leading cybersecurity efforts as the Chief Information Security Officer at UC Merced. He is an advocate of lifelong learning and teaches graduate business analytics courses at Saint Mary's College of California. He is an accredited ISACA CGEIT and CRISC trainer and serves as the Government and Regulatory Advocacy Director for ISACA Sacramento Chapter. His current research interests are cybersecurity, privacy, digital transformation, business analytics, and educational IT programs. He holds the following certifications; CISSP, CRISC, CGEIT, CISA, CISM, CDPSE, PMP, PgMP, CBAP, ITIL Expert, ITIL 4 MP, TOGAF 9 Certified, COBIT F, CSSBB, PCI-ISA, AWS Cloud Practitioner, and PROSCI. Dr. Kizilelma also holds a BS degree in computer engineering, an MBA, and PhD focusing on information security, quality, and patient safety.

Trinh Ngo, Senior Manager, IT Compliance for Blue Shield of CA
Education: MBA, Certified PMP, CISA, CISM, CRISC, CDPSE, ITIL, Accredited CISA Trainer
Experience: 25+ years in Information Technology in various industries including healthcare, bulk electric utility, and financial services. Started as a business analyst at Freddie Mac and transitioned to a systems analyst. She started her development career at Comedy Central in New York, and left the east coast to work on startups and finally settled in the Sacramento area with California ISO and Blue Shield of CA. Sits on the ISACA Sacramento Board of Directors, and donates time to women and children organizations to give back. Believes that relationships and servant leadership is how to achieve sustainable success for teams, business partners, and customers.

Richard Swain is a certified security architect with broad information technology background and technical management experience who advises external clients on information security improvements and their contribution to business outcomes. He is experienced with state and local government, healthcare and higher education. Richard has a deep background in data protection and data lifecycle management. He holds certifications in CCSP, CIPM, CISSP, and CRISC, and is a board member of ISACA Sacramento Chapter.
